'use strict';
const crypto = require('node:crypto');
const path = require('node:path');
const browserslist = require('browserslist');
const { DefinePlugin, ProvidePlugin } = require('webpack');
const TerserPlugin = require('terser-webpack-plugin');
const HtmlWebpackPlugin = require('html-webpack-plugin');
const CssMinimizerPlugin = require('css-minimizer-webpack-plugin');
const TsconfigPathsPlugin = require('tsconfig-paths-webpack-plugin');
const ReactRefreshWebpackPlugin = require('@pmmmwh/react-refresh-webpack-plugin');
const { BundleAnalyzerPlugin } = require('webpack-bundle-analyzer');
const CopyWebpackPlugin = require('copy-webpack-plugin');
const isDevelopment = process.env.NODE_ENV !== 'production';
// const isProduction = process.env.NODE_ENV === 'production';
const topLevelFrameworkPaths = isDevelopment ? [] : getTopLevelFrameworkPaths(__dirname);
const isAnalyze = !!process.env.ANALYZE;
const cpuCount = require('node:os').cpus().length;
const context = __dirname;
const targets = browserslist.loadConfig({ path: context });
/** @type {import('webpack').Configuration} */
const config = {
mode: isDevelopment ? 'development' : 'production',
output: {
library: '_SKK',
publicPath: '/', // Make it easy to configure CDN's cache-control
filename: isDevelopment ? '_sukka/static/[name].js' : '_sukka/static/[name]-[contenthash].js',
crossOriginLoading: 'anonymous',
hashFunction: 'xxhash64',
hashDigestLength: 16,
clean: true
},
context,
name: 'dashflare',
experiments: { asyncWebAssembly: true, topLevelAwait: true, css: true },
resolve: {
extensions: ['.mjs', '.js', '.cjs', '.tsx', '.mts', '.ts', '.cts', '.jsx', '.json'],
importsFields: ['import', 'module', 'browser', 'default', 'require'],
fallback: {
https: false,
http: false
// crypto: require.resolve('crypto-browserify'),
// stream: require.resolve('stream-browserify'),
},
plugins: [new TsconfigPathsPlugin()]
},
devtool: isDevelopment ? 'eval-source-map' : false,
devServer: {
port: 3000,
hot: true,
historyApiFallback: {
disableDotRule: true
},
compress: false,
static: {
directory: path.join(__dirname, 'public')
},
proxy: [
{
context: ['/_sukka/api'],
target: 'https://api.cloudflare.com',
pathRewrite: { '^/_sukka/api': '' },
secure: false,
changeOrigin: true
}
]
},
module: {
rules: [
{
test: /assets\//,
type: 'asset/resource',
generator: {
filename: isDevelopment ? '_sukka/static/[name][ext][query]' : '_sukka/static/[hash][ext][query]'
}
},
{
test: /\.[cm]?[jt]sx?$/,
exclude: /node_modules/,
use: {
loader: 'swc-loader',
options: {
jsc: {
parser: {
syntax: 'typescript',
tsx: true
},
externalHelpers: true,
loose: false,
target: undefined,
transform: {
react: {
runtime: 'automatic',
refresh: isDevelopment,
development: isDevelopment
},
optimizer: {
simplify: true
}
},
baseUrl: __dirname,
paths: {
'@/*': ['src/*']
}
},
env: {
// swc-loader don't read browserslist config file, manually specify targets
targets,
mode: 'usage',
loose: false,
coreJs: '3.30',
shippedProposals: false,
exclude: ['es.error.cause']
}
}
}
}
]
},
optimization: {
splitChunks: isDevelopment
? false
: {
cacheGroups: {
framework: {
chunks: 'all',
name: 'framework',
test(module) {
const resource = module.nameForCondition?.();
/* A list of packages that are used in the top level of the application. */
return resource
? topLevelFrameworkPaths.some((pkgPath) => resource.startsWith(pkgPath))
: false;
},
priority: 40,
// Don't let webpack eliminate this chunk (prevents this chunk from
// becoming a part of the commons chunk)
enforce: true
},
lib: {
test(module) {
return (
module.size() > 160000
&& /node_modules[/\\]/.test(module.nameForCondition() || '')
);
},
name(module) {
const hash = crypto.createHash('sha1');
if (isModuleCSS(module)) {
module.updateHash(hash);
} else {
if (!module.libIdent) {
throw new Error(
`Encountered unknown module type: ${module.type}. Please open an issue.`
);
}
hash.update(module.libIdent({ context }));
}
return hash.digest('hex').slice(0, 8);
},
priority: 30,
minChunks: 1,
reuseExistingChunk: true
}
},
maxInitialRequests: 25,
minSize: 20000
},
runtimeChunk: {
name: 'webpack'
},
minimize: !isDevelopment,
minimizer: [
new TerserPlugin({
minify: TerserPlugin.swcMinify,
parallel: cpuCount,
terserOptions: {
compress: {
ecma: 5,
// The following two options are known to break valid JavaScript code
comparisons: false,
inline: 2 // https://github.com/vercel/next.js/issues/7178#issuecomment-493048965
},
mangle: { safari10: true },
format: {
// use ecma 2015 to enable minify like shorthand objec
ecma: 2015,
safari10: true,
comments: false,
// Fixes usage of Emoji and certain Regex
ascii_only: true
}
}
}),
new CssMinimizerPlugin({
minify: CssMinimizerPlugin.lightningCssMinify
})
]
},
plugins: [
new CopyWebpackPlugin({
patterns: [
{ from: 'public', to: '' }
]
}),
new ProvidePlugin({
// Polyfill for Node global "Buffer" variable
Buffer: [require.resolve('buffer'), 'Buffer']
}),
new HtmlWebpackPlugin({
template: './src/index.html'
}),
new DefinePlugin({
'process.env.NODE_DEBUG': 'undefined',
'process.env.engine': `((ua) => (ua.includes('Chrome') || ua.includes('Chromium')
? 'chromium'
: ua.includes('Firefox')
? 'firefox'
: 'safari'))(navigator.userAgent)`,
'process.env.NODE_ENV': JSON.stringify(isDevelopment ? 'development' : 'production'),
'process.browser': JSON.stringify(true),
'global.GENTLY': JSON.stringify(false),
'process.env.CLOUDFLARE_API_ENDPOINT': JSON.stringify(process.env.CLOUDFLARE_API_ENDPOINT || null)
}),
isDevelopment && new ReactRefreshWebpackPlugin(),
isAnalyze && new BundleAnalyzerPlugin({
analyzerMode: 'static'
})
].filter(Boolean),
performance: false
};
module.exports = config;
/** Utility */
/**
* @param {string} module
* @returns {boolean}
*/
function isModuleCSS(module) {
return (
// mini-css-extract-plugin
module.type === 'css/mini-extract'
// extract-css-chunks-webpack-plugin (old)
|| module.type === 'css/extract-chunks'
// extract-css-chunks-webpack-plugin (new)
|| module.type === 'css/extract-css-chunks'
);
}
/**
* Packages which will be split into the 'framework' chunk.
* Only top-level packages are included, e.g. nested copies like
* 'node_modules/meow/node_modules/object-assign' are not included
*
* @param {string} dir
* @returns {string[]}
*/
function getTopLevelFrameworkPaths(dir) {
/** @type {Set<string>} */
const visitedFrameworkPackages = new Set();
const topLevelFrameworkPaths = [];
/**
* Adds package-paths of dependencies recursively
*
* @param {string} packageName
* @param {string} relativeToPath
* @returns {void}
*/
// Adds package-paths of dependencies recursively
const addPackagePath = (packageName, relativeToPath) => {
try {
if (visitedFrameworkPackages.has(packageName)) return;
visitedFrameworkPackages.add(packageName);
const packageJsonPath = require.resolve(`${packageName}/package.json`, {
paths: [relativeToPath]
});
// Include a trailing slash so that a `.startsWith(packagePath)` check avoids false positives
// when one package name starts with the full name of a different package.
// For example:
// "node_modules/react-slider".startsWith("node_modules/react") // true
// "node_modules/react-slider".startsWith("node_modules/react/") // false
const directory = path.join(packageJsonPath, '../');
// Returning from the function in case the directory has already been added and traversed
if (topLevelFrameworkPaths.includes(directory)) return;
topLevelFrameworkPaths.push(directory);
const dependencies = require(packageJsonPath).dependencies || {};
for (const name of Object.keys(dependencies)) {
addPackagePath(name, directory);
}
} catch {
// don't error on failing to resolve framework packages
}
};
for (const packageName of ['react', 'react-dom']) {
addPackagePath(packageName, dir);
}
return topLevelFrameworkPaths;
}
